Control of a quantum particle in a moving box
This 1-D Schrödinger equation describes the non relativistic motion of a single charged particle (mass m = 1, = 1) with a potential V in a uniform electric field t → u(t). With v̈ = −u, (1) represents also the dynamics of a particle in a non Galilean frame of absolute position v (see, e.g., [9]). متن کاملNumerical simulation of a quantum particle in a box
It is shown how one can get numerical prediction of quantum mechanical particle behaviour without using the Schrödinger equation. The main steps of this development are the non-differentiability hypothesis, the equations of motion entailed by this hypothesis, and the numerical formulation of a simple one-dimensional problem: the particle in a box.
متن کاملBerry phase for a particle in an infinite spherical potential well with moving wall
In this paper we calculate the Berry phase for a wave function of a particle in an infinite spherical potential well with adiabatically varying. In order to do this, we need the solutions of the corresponding Schrödinger equation with a time dependent Hamiltonian. Here, we obtain these solutions for the first time.
